Tree crown shaping services involve the careful trimming and pruning of a tree’s uppermost branches to improve its overall form and health. This process typically includes removing dead, diseased, or overgrown limbs to promote better growth patterns and enhance the tree’s appearance. Skilled professionals use specialized techniques to ensure that the crown is balanced and aesthetically pleasing while maintaining the tree’s structural integrity. The goal is to create a uniform, well-shaped canopy that complements the surrounding landscape and allows for better sunlight penetration and airflow.
These services help address common problems such as overgrowth that can interfere with nearby structures, power lines, or other trees. Overgrown crowns may also pose safety risks if branches become weak or brittle, increasing the likelihood of falling limbs during storms or high winds. Additionally, crown shaping can reduce the risk of pests and disease by removing compromised branches and improving overall tree health. Proper pruning can also prevent branches from obstructing views, walkways, or solar panels, making it a practical solution for property owners seeking to maintain safety and visual appeal.

The overview below groups typical Tree Crown Sha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Dracut,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Crown Shaping - The cost for standard crown shaping typically 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the tree. Smaller trees or simple trims t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um, while larger or more intricate work may cost more.
Moderate Crown Shaping - For more detailed shaping or thinning, prices usually fall between $400 and $800. This service often involves careful pruning to improve tree health and aesthetics in residential or commercial landscapes.
Advanced Crown Shaping - Extensive crown modification or sculpting can range from $800 to $1,500 or higher. Such projects may include significant crown reduction or shaping for safety or design purposes.
Additional Service Fees - Extra charges may apply for difficult access, special equipment, or removal of large branches, which can add $50 to $300 to the overall cost.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ific tree con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
Tree Crown Shaping services involve trimming and pruning to improve the structure and appearance of tree crowns. Local professionals can help create a balanced and aesthetically pleasing canopy for residential or commercial properties.
Tree Crown Thinning focuses on selectively removing branches to reduce density and improve light penetration. Service providers can assist in maintaining healthy growth while enhancing the tree's overall form.
Tree Crown Reduction involves carefully reducing the size of a tree's crown to prevent interference with structures or power lines. Local experts can perform these services to ensure safety and proper tree health.
Formative Crown Shaping is tailored for young or newly planted trees to develop a strong, desirable shape early on. Professionals can guide the shaping process to promote healthy growth habits.
Structural Tree Pruning aims to remove weak or crossing branches to improve the tree's stability and safety. Local service providers can assess and perform pruning to reduce potential hazards.
Selective Crown Pruning enhances the visual appeal of trees by removing specific branches for a cleaner look. Skilled pros can execute precise pruning for aesthetic and health benefits.
